Índice:
2025 Autor: John Day | [email protected]. Última modificação: 2025-01-13 06:58
Uma maneira muito FÁCIL e GRATUITA para QUALQUER UM escrever seu primeiro programa de computador em DEZ MINUTOS. Nota: Este instrutível é para pessoas que pensam que programar é algum tipo de coisa mágica que você precisa de programas caros ou habilidades de alta tecnologia para fazer. Esperançosamente, esta instrução irá remover o véu de seus olhos para mostrar a eles que é fácil e acessível para qualquer pessoa com um computador. Se você quiser saber mais, compre um livro. Os livros 'Sam's Teach Yourself… in 30 days' são bons.
Etapa 1: Obtenha as coisas necessárias
estaremos programando na linguagem de programação Perl porque é muito fácil de usar e gratuita. Além disso, você pode integrá-lo facilmente com a Internet, etc. Portanto, você precisará de um 'Interpretador Perl' para entender o código que você digita. Obtenha ActivePerl (um intérprete Perl) aqui: https://www.activestate.com/Products/ActivePerl/clique em download, digite um nome falso, etc. Se estiver usando o Windows, baixe o MSI, se não funcionar, baixe o pacote AS. baixado, instale-o (apenas clique duas vezes nele e use todas as opções padrão na instalação).
Etapa 2: Verifique se você instalou corretamente
se você for paranóico e quiser ver se ele foi instalado corretamente, vá ao prompt do DOS e digite: perl -v
ele deve mostrar a você todas as informações da versão. para abrir o prompt do DOS: A) Encontre-o no menu iniciar (veja a imagem abaixo: "Iniciar", "Programas", "Acessórios", "Prompt de comando") OU B) você pode apenas clicar em "Iniciar" e depois em "Executar "e digite cmd.exe na janela exibida.
Etapa 3: Escreva seu primeiro programa
inicie um editor de texto (como 'notepad.exe' que vem com o Windows; NÃO - use o word ou o wordpad, eles adicionam coisas invisíveis ao texto!). Você pode encontrar o bloco de notas na mesma parte do menu iniciar que o prompt do DOS (veja a foto na etapa anterior). Eu gosto de usar o EditPad.exe, que obtive gratuitamente na internet: https://www.editpadpro.com/editpadclassic.htmlescreva seu primeiro programa: #! / usr / bin / env perlprint "Hello, World! / n"; salve-o como hello.pl (certifique-se de salvá-lo com.pl como extensão, não hello.pl.txt). Para garantir que '.txt' não seja adicionado automaticamente ao seu nome de arquivo, clique em 'Qualquer arquivo (".")' Ao lado de 'Salvar como tipo'. (veja a imagem abaixo) Além disso, para tornar mais fácil o teste, salve-o no diretório c: / Perl (ou onde quer que você tenha instalado o interpretador Perl, por padrão ele é instalado em c: / Perl).
#! / usr / bin / env perl é uma porcaria que você deve colocar no início de todos os seus programas. / n é o símbolo para uma nova linha. Então, quando Perl vê isso, ele move o cursor para a próxima linha (como quando você pressiona a tecla Enter)
Etapa 4: execute seu programa
vá para o prompt de comando do DOS (ou janela do DOS no Windows), vá para o diretório do interpretador Perl, por exemplo c: / perl
se você não sabe como mudar os diretórios no DOS, faça isso da seguinte maneira: cd c: / perl, em seguida, digite perl -w hello.pl (você também pode simplesmente digitar hello.pl se tiver associado os arquivos.pl o interpretador Perl durante a instalação), você deverá ver Hello World! yay !!, seu programa funciona !! Se não, você errou / pulou uma das etapas acima.
Etapa 5: Escreva programas melhores
Para escrever programas mais interessantes, encontre códigos de exemplo na Internet ou compre um livro. Sempre gostei dos livros "Sams Teach Yourself … in 21 days". Aqui estão alguns bons sites para aprender mais Perl (encontrado no Google: tutorial Perl) https://www.pageresource.com/cgirec/ index2.htmhttps://www.sthomas.net/oldpages/roberts-perl-tutorial.htmhttps://www.ebb.org/PickingUpPerl/================== =================================================== O "Sam's Teach Yourself … in 21 dias "são excelentes livros para aprender _QUALQUER_ linguagem de programação (já os usei em várias): Ótimos livros de programação, obtive o desenho abaixo em: